Hoodlums Kill Vigilante, Flee With His Motorcycle In Kwara

Suspected motorcycle thieves last Friday’s night reportedly stabbed a member of a vigilance group, Samuel Jiyah to death in Lade village in Patigi local government area of Kwara State.

LEADERSHIP gathered that the incident occurred when the victim was returning from Ekati village on a motorcycle.

Jiyah’s assailants, it was learnt, took away his Bajaj motorcycle and other valuables.

The deceased’s in-law, Tsado Isaac, confirmed the incident to LEADERSHIP in Ilorin, the state capital yesterday. He said that the victim was attacked by motorcycle snatchers in Lade village.

“They attacked him when he was returning from Ekati around Gbadebo farms in the night,” Tsadso stated.

A friend of the victim, Gbenga Aro, also confirmed that Jiyah was attacked during the night while returning from his village, adding that, his corpse was found in a bushy area by women who were fetching firewood in the farm on Saturday’s morning.

He added that the deceased’s family members were informed and his corpse was taken to his village, Ekati, where he was buried immediately.

As of the time of filing this report, the spokesman of Kwara State police command, Okasannmi Ajayi, could not be reached for his comments on the incident.
